At any given point, therefore, we have a range of issues where we are managing the past and investing for the future. Having said that, however, everyone who brings an issue to us in respect of an opportunity to improve or a concern about safety provides us with an opportunity to make a difference. To take one example, when we investigated the first protected disclosure to the Minister regarding fluid-filled cables our investigation came up with the finding that there was an opportunity for us to improve our liaison and reporting with the local authorities. That was despite the fact that we had reported each and every leak to water in the last 26 years. There was an opportunity to do that better. We have now put in place a protocol with each of those local authorities for reporting any future leakage. As a result, it has been an opportunity for us to improve.
